TOPIC: Saintly Runestone with spells ??

Saintly Runestone with spells ?? 1 month 2 weeks ago #1

The new Saintly Runestone adds +1 Sacred damage to Ranged attacks. If I play a caster class and turn one in would my spell damage increase by +1 because spells are Ranged attacks? I've always viewed the Runestones as benefiting Melee or physical Ranged attacks but I'm guessing this one would also increase spell damage??

Saintly Runestone with spells ?? 1 month 2 weeks ago #7

I would say yes to turn undead. According to the players handbook

If a cleric has a Spell Damage bonus, the extra
damage from that gets added as a pool to the cleric’s
turn undead damage. If a cleric has a Spell Damage
bonus, everything mentioned above is still true. It is
only the extra damage from their Spell Damage
bonus that gets pooled.


Any ranged damage should also increase spell damage, so it should count when using turn undead. But as mentioned above, it would get added as a pool that can be allocated, but would not increase the damage to every monster.
